Chlorine in PDB 2inb: Crystal Structure of An Xish Family Protein (ZP_00107633.1) From Nostoc Punctiforme Pcc 73102 at 1.60 A Resolution

Protein crystallography data

The structure of Crystal Structure of An Xish Family Protein (ZP_00107633.1) From Nostoc Punctiforme Pcc 73102 at 1.60 A Resolution, PDB code: 2inb was solved by Joint Center For Structural Genomics (Jcsg), with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 29.78 / 1.60
Space group P 31 2 1
Cell size a, b, c (Å), α, β, γ (°) 59.554, 59.554, 71.563, 90.00, 90.00, 120.00
R / Rfree (%) 15.8 / 19.1
